Fairmont rests in the lowlands, where the land hums with a quiet persistence. It lies 40.7 miles south-south-west of Fayetteville, NC (from Fayetteville, NC: bearing 199°T), and is situated 10.3 miles south-west of Lumberton. The terrain here is flat, giving way to broad fields that stretch towards a horizon often softened by the humid air. Cypress and pine trees, their needles catching the diffused sunlight, edge the scattered waterways that thread through the landscape like silver ribbons. The air itself carries a certain weight, thick with the scent of damp earth and distant pine resin, especially after a summer rain, when the world seems to exhale a deep, green breath. This is a place where the sky feels immense, a vast, pale canvas that can shift from a gentle, washed-out blue to the bruised purples of an approaching storm with a remarkable speed. The history of Fairmont is tied to the rich agricultural soil that has sustained it for generations, a legacy of cotton fields and the industrious spirit that cultivated them. The local economy, while evolving, still bears the imprint of its agrarian past, with farming remaining a vital, if sometimes challenging, endeavor. Beyond the fields, the community has cultivated a distinctive character, a blend of Southern hospitality and a pragmatic resilience that speaks of enduring its share of hard seasons. While no grand monuments dominate the skyline, the true landmarks of Fairmont are etched into the everyday: the solid brick of its older buildings, the slow, unhurried pace of life on its tree-lined streets, and the quiet hum of conversations drifting from porch swings on warm evenings.
